OJT in Zaječar launched an investigation into the illegal mining of sand and gravel on Crni Timok following Polekol’s report

On the upper reaches of the Crni Timok, in the village of Mali Izvor in the municipality of Boljevac, in the immediate vicinity of the "Ponorske ćuprije" bridge, large amounts of sand and gravel were illegally mined during the winter, which led to the destruction of a part of the river bed and shore, damaged the habitat of protected species, and altered the course of the river, which caused catastrophic ecological consequences.

Demand for responsibility – who protects nature?

On the occasion of the issuance of the Decision on conditions for nature protection - Project "Jadar", 32 civil society organizations dealing with nature protection call on the Government of Serbia and the Ministry of Environmental Protection to take responsibility and take measures to sanction those responsible in the Institute for Nature Protection of Serbia for the non-transparent and illegitimate process of issuing nature protection conditions for the "Jadar" project.
